PROGRAM DESCRIPTION :

WES at Philly Home at Girard (2100 W. Girard Ave, Phila PA) and the Riverview Wellness Village (7979 State Road, Phila PA) is an outpatient level of behavioral health care co-located within a shelter for those with housing needs and individuals living in recovery housing within the Riverview Wellness Village in Philadelphia. These housing programs are part of the Pathways to Wellness initiative within the Philadelphia Wellness Ecosystem. Services include care coordination, case management, individual and group therapy and psychiatric care for individuals with a history of substance use. Individuals challenged with substance use disorders often struggle with either seeking treatment or attending treatment consistently. Grounded in a "meet people where they are approach", this program aims to provide individuals with convenient and consistent access to behavioral health services where they reside. The WES multidisciplinary team collaborates with housing providers, primary care physicians, employment supports, substance use treatment providers and more in this integrated program.
